History
In 1976 the first E&A Championship were held at Princes Club (GBR). Mike Thomas (GBR) and Penny Lowden (GBR) became the first E&A Champions.
Only two years after the first E&A Championships, the European Challenge Series was created. Initially planned to give skiers the opportunity to meet themselves more often than during World and E&A Championships only, it was also the possibility for countries to organise inernational events.
Michelle Doherty (GBR) was the first World Champion from Europe. She won the jump event 1986.

European Champions 2011
Marc Niebuhr (GER) - Junior Boys
Hannah Bullard (GBR) - Junior Girls and open women
Clement Maillard (FRA) - open men
The 36th E&A Championships were held on the private lake of Saint Prest near the city of Chartres (FRA).
